Parish Barbecue
Parish Barbecue blends Texas and Louisiana flavors with hickory-smoked brisket and homemade sausages. The crawfish cornbread dressing is a standout, and the smoked vegetable muffuletta offers a veggie-friendly twist. A must-visit for BBQ lovers. Read More
Mian & Bao
This Triangle gem brings West Coast flair with spicy Sichuan marinated cucumbers and delicate Shanghainese bao. The bold flavors and crunchy textures make it a top pick for Asian cuisine fans, despite tricky parking. Read More
Mission Burger Co.
Mission Burger Co. at Barley Bean Cafe serves all-day vegan burgers that rival their meaty counterparts. Juicy patties and creative toppings make this a go-to for plant-based diners. Read More
